To attenuate these challenges we area a guard column prior to the analytical column. A Guard column ordinarily consists of a similar particulate packing materials and stationary section since the analytical column, but is considerably shorter and less expensive—a duration of seven.five mm and a price just one-tenth of that for the corresponding analytical column is standard. Mainly because they are meant to be sacrificial, guard columns are replaced consistently.

順相クロマトグラフィーは高速液体クロマトグラフィーにおいて最初に使われた。固定相に高極性のもの(シリカゲル)を、移動相に低極性のもの(例えばヘキサン、酢酸エチル、クロロホルムなどの有機溶媒)を用いる。分析物はより極性の高いほどより強く固定相と相互作用して溶出が遅くなる。また極性の高い物質の割合が多い移動相ほど溶出が早くなる。順相タイプは近年の逆相タイプの発展とともに使われることが少なくなったが、順相タイプは逆相タイプをはじめとする他の分離モードとは異なった特性を持つため、目的によっては非常に有効なものとなる。例えば、逆相タイプでは分離が困難なトコフェロールの異性体や保持の困難な糖類を容易に相互分析することができ、また主に水を含まない移動相を用いるので、水に難溶の脂溶性ビタミンや加水分解されやすい酸無水物などの化合物の分離に好適である。

The elution get of solutes in HPLC is ruled by polarity. For a standard-stage separation, a solute of lower polarity spends proportionally less time in the polar stationary period and elutes just before a solute which is far more polar. Specified a particular stationary section, retention situations in ordinary-period HPLC are managed by modifying the mobile period’s Homes. For instance, In the event the resolution involving two solutes is inadequate, switching to the much less polar cell phase retains the solutes about the column for a longer time and delivers extra possibility for his or her separation.
